Dynatrap makes insect traps that work on the same precept as others. They entice flying bugs with warmth and carbon dioxide, then catch them and forestall them from escaping. For warmth, they use a fluorescent extremely-violet bulb, which additionally emits Zappify Bug Zapper-attracting gentle. The primary distinction is that they don’t use propane to create carbon dioxide (CO2). Instead, they use a special course of. More on that below. Since they don’t use propane, that means no want to buy and alter cylinders, and better of all, no maintenance issues with clogged traces or failure of the propane to light-points that hassle many different traps. You still must plug them in, so you’ll need an outdoor outlet and an extension cord if you would like dangle the trap greater than 7-10 feet from the outlet. The DT2000XL mannequin is dearer than the DT1000 model, but it’s bigger, bug zapper light zapper for camping with a stronger fan and brilliant gentle, and may entice bugs from farther away, with coverage up to an acre for the DT2000XL and a half-acre for the DT1000, according to the manufacturer.

The lights in the top of the entice emit warmth and ultraviolet rays, which entice mosquitoes as well as different insects, significantly moths at night. There are openings below the lights the place bugs can fly in. Once inside, they’re sucked down by the fan’s air currents into the retaining cage under, where they’re unable to flee and die within a day. Unfortunately, mild and warmth are just two of the issues that entice mosquitoes, since what they’re primarily looking for are people to chew.
